INTEW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review
26 of the 5,805 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Integral Acquisition Corporation 1 Warrants (INTEW)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$3.55M — down 0.67% from $3.58M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 4 funds opened new INTEW positions and 3 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 4 added to existing stakes and 2 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Periscope Capital, adding an estimated $76K. The largest seller was K2 Principal Fund, exiting entirely with an estimated $42K sold.
